#201c1c color RGB value is (32,28,28). #201c1c color name is Custom Color color.

#201c1c hex color red value is 32, green value is 28 and the blue value of its RGB is 28.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#201c1c hue: 0.00, saturation: 0.07 and the lightness value of 201c1c is 0.12.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#201c1c color hex is 0.00, 0.12, 0.12, 0.87. Web safe color of #201c1c is #333333. Color #201c1c contains mainly BLACK color.

About #201C1C Custom Color

#201C1C (Custom Color) is a black-based color with RGB values of 32, 28, 28. This color belongs to the black color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#201c1c,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#201c1c can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#201c1c), RGB (rgb(32, 28, 28)), HSL (hsl(0, 7%, 12%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#333333,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
